Output 21e8686a0c94590dfe945b4bf6c9e89717066067af831f57527152131ea71d09:0

value
8489205
script pubkey
OP_0 OP_PUSHBYTES_20 e32fdc9c1fe6ca6ab7dd77b52539ac8f141a4aed
address
bc1quvhae8qlum9x4d7aw76j2wdv3u2p5jhddkfqmp
transaction
21e8686a0c94590dfe945b4bf6c9e89717066067af831f57527152131ea71d09
spent
true